National Day of Service and Remembrance is the largest annual day of charitable service in the United States, when 30 million Americans participate. It was founded by the nonprofit MyGoodDeed in 2002, and its mission “is to transform 9/11 into a day of unity, empathy and service as an enduring and positive tribute to those lost and injured on 9/11, and the many who rose in service in response to the attacks, including first responders, recovery workers, volunteers and members of our military.” The day was formally recognized by federal law by the passage of the Edward M. Kennedy Serve America Act, which passed in 2009. Beginning in 2009, President Obama’s proclamation for Patriot Day also included a proclamation for National Day of Service and Remembrance Day.

    Model Marian Avila wears an outfit from the Talisha White 2019 spring collection on the runway during Fashion Week, Saturday, Sept. 8, 2018, in New York. Avila, a 21-year-old Spanish model with Down syndrome, fulfilled her dream to walk at New York Fashion Week thanks to White, the Atlanta designer she met through the magic of social media.
